Licensing and Brand Credibility
Formal checks start with the licence number at the bottom of the page. That number should match the stated regulator, and the legal entity name should appear in the terms. Missing ownership details usually deserve a cautious reading, because transparency at the licensing level tends to predict transparency everywhere else. Country access lists also matter – Europe has different rules block by block, and a reliable casino states clearly where it cannot accept players.

Banking: The Fine Print Matters More Than the Banner
Banking pages deserve close reading before any deposit. EUR handling and transfer speed are the first things UK players usually check. This checklist helps avoid surprises:
Confirm the EUR balance and local deposit currency options
Review minimum deposit and withdrawal thresholds before playing
Check payout processing time for cards, wallets, and bank transfers
Complete verification documents before requesting the first withdrawal
Save screenshots of transactions for support reference if needed
Withdrawal timing is often the part readers check twice. Pending time and actual bank time are not the same thing. Some methods clear faster after KYC is complete; others sit in a queue through weekends. Daily cut-off times matter more than bold promises on the cashier page.
Bonuses: Reading Past the Headline Number
Welcome offers matter only when the rules are readable. Wagering requirements, expiry dates, and game restrictions decide the real value. A small free spins pack with fair terms beats a large headline number wrapped in tight restrictions. Live table promos often follow different contribution rules than slots, so the terms need a line-by-line read. Here are the checkpoints before any offer looks worth taking:
Wagering requirements and game contribution rules
Maximum bonus bet during active play
Free spins expiry and eligibility limits
Cashout caps and restricted payment methods
Bonus stacking rules during seasonal offers
